Of the 28 NFL teams in action yesterday, 11 scored 22 or more points (neither the Lions or Chiefs reached that number on Thursday night). Those 11 teams went 10-1, with of course the Chargers being the one.

Haven't been able to find exact numbers this morning, but I have to imagine teams that score 30 or more AND win the turnover battle by 2 or more win at least 98% of the time. The Chargers have now lost two straight such games to teams from Florida :)

Two more stats:

(1) Since 2000, teams that rushed for more than 200 yards, allowed
fewer than 100 rushing yards, did not turn the ball over and won the
turnover margin by at least two were 110-0 (per Popper).

(2) The Chargers' defense set a team record with 466 passing yards
allowed (per the AP).

Those are both incredible stats. Given the shootouts the Air Coryell teams used to get into, you'd think they would have given up 470-500 at least once.

Someday the Chargers are going to achieve the Holy Grail of losing - they'll simultaneously set records for biggest turnover margin lost with and biggest lead blown in the same game. Currently, those records stand at +7 (Tampa Bay lost to Pittsburgh 17-12 in 1983 despite winning the turnover battle 7-0) and 33 (the Vikings beat the Colts 39-36 in OT last year after trailing 33-0 at halftime). Somehow, some way, the Chargers will build a 34-0 lead thanks to 8 turnovers and then give it away to lose 35-34 without turning the ball over themselves.
